The Lady Rebels of UNLV made a commanding statement on the court Wednesday afternoon, rebounding from their recent setback with a decisive victory over the UCF Knights, by a score of 71-52. Reporting by News 3 LV highlights that the win at the UNLV Thanksgiving Classic improved the Lady Rebels' record to 5-2 for the season.

Leading the charge for UNLV was sophomore forward McKinna Brackens who, according to UNLV Rebels News, put up a career-high 19 points and 14 rebounds. Brackens's performance was not just about numbers; she was a force on the defensive glass, snagging 12 defensive boards to set the tone for the game. Amarachi Kimpson also played a pivotal role with her 18 points, keeping the momentum in the Lady Rebels’ favor.

The statistical rundown revealed a distinct advantage for UNLV, with the team shooting an impressive 50% from the field and 46.7% from behind the arc. In stark contrast, UCF struggled to find their rhythm, shooting a mere 29.0% from the field throughout the contest. The Lady Rebels also out-rebounded the Knights 45-40, further cementing their dominance on the court that afternoon, as reported by UNLV Rebels News.

UNLV's head coach Lindy La Rocque expressed her pride in the team's comeback. She said, "This was a bounce back game for us. We've been working really hard since our last game on being focused on what we need to improve upon and I'm extremely proud of our group for coming out here and doing it," in a statement obtained by UNLV Rebels News. La Rocque also lauded Brackens for her hard work and improvement from her freshman year. It wasn't just the stars who received praise, as the coach highlighted the contributions from players like Erica Collins, who "was huge in the game getting minutes in both halves and being a force in the battle."

The win signifies more than just an addition to the win column for the Lady Rebels; it's a moment that evens the all-time series with UCF at one win a piece and sets a forward-looking tone as the Lady Rebels continue to navigate the season.
